Big 12 Baseball Championship Returns to Chickasaw Bricktown Ballpark 2016-2020

Published on May 28, 2015 under Pacific Coast League (PCL1)
Oklahoma City Comets News Release


OKLAHOMA CITY - The Big 12 Conference announced today that Oklahoma City, the Oklahoma City All Sports Association and Chickasaw Bricktown Ballpark will host the 2017-2020 Phillips Big 12 Baseball Championship.

Chickasaw Bricktown Ballpark, home of the Oklahoma City Dodgers, was already slated to host the 2016 Phillips Big 12 Baseball Championship and will now host the next five baseball championships with the extension.

"The OKC Dodgers are proud to partner with the Oklahoma City All Sports Association and the Big 12 Conference on hosting this premier event," said OKC Dodgers President/General Manager Michael Byrnes. "The Bricktown community and Chickasaw Bricktown Ballpark are the perfect location for this event and the fans that support it."

Oklahoma City has hosted the Big 12 Baseball Championship 16 of the last 19 years, including 10 of the last 11 years.

OKC Awarded Big 12 Baseball and Women's Basketball Championships

OKLAHOMA CITY - Today, the Big 12 Conference announced futures sites for its Big 12 Championships. Oklahoma City and Oklahoma City All Sports was awarded the 2017-2020 Big 12 Baseball Championship and the 2017-2019 Big 12 Women's Basketball Championship.

Both the Phillips 66 Big 12 Baseball and Women's Basketball Championships were already scheduled to return to Oklahoma City in 2016, but with the extension, Oklahoma City will host the next five baseball championships and the next four women's basketball championships.

"We are ecstatic to bring back both Big 12 Baseball and Women's Basketball Championships back to Oklahoma City," said All Sports Executive Director Tim Brassfield. "We have a long and storied history with the Big 12 Baseball Championship and Oklahoma City has shown their strong support of Big 12 Women's Basketball when it has hosted previously, including having the highest attended women's championship of all time."

The Big 12 Baseball Championship will return and be played at the Chickasaw Bricktown Ballpark while the Big 12 Women's Basketball Championship will continue to be played at the Chesapeake Energy Arena.

Oklahoma City has hosted the Big 12 Baseball Championship 16 of the last 19 years, including 10 of the last 11 years. Tulsa served as host in 2015.

The Big 12 Women's Basketball Championship has been hosted in Oklahoma City 3 times in the last 9 years (2007, 2009 and 2014).

The Oklahoma City All Sports Association is a non-profit 501(c)(3) corporation, which is proud to serve as the sports commission for Oklahoma City. It is one of the oldest sports commissions in the country, contributing more than 50 years of great service to the city. The Oklahoma City All Sports Association exists to SECURE, CREATE, PROMOTE, EXECUTE and HOST quality, family-oriented amateur sporting events in the state of Oklahoma.
